Job Title: Head of Quality and Safety

Western Care is seeking an exceptional professional to lead our Quality and Safety efforts. As a key member of our senior management team, you will be responsible for developing and implementing strategies to ensure the highest standards of quality and safety across all services.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Develop and implement a comprehensive quality and safety strategy that aligns with organizational goals and objectives.
  • Lead the development and implementation of policies and procedures related to quality and safety.
  • Collaborate with department heads and service managers to identify areas for improvement and develop plans to address them.
  • Monitor and evaluate the effectiveness of quality and safety initiatives and make recommendations for improvement.
  • Provide training and support to staff on quality and safety best practices.


Required Skills and Qualifications:

Education:
A relevant third-level qualification in quality, safety, risk management, or clinical governance in healthcare at level 8 (or higher) on the Quality and Qualifications Ireland (QQI) framework or equivalent.

Experience:
Management experience at a senior level in a healthcare setting for a minimum of three years.

Skillset:
Excellent understanding of clinical governance, service planning, service provision, and resource management.
Robust understanding of Regulation and HIQA framework.
Experience of working in a post that has involved safety, risk management, quality improvement, and regulatory compliance.

Personal Attributes:
Strong leadership and management skills.
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
Ability to work collaboratively with diverse teams and stakeholders.

Benefits:

Competitive salary
Pension and life insurance scheme
Annual leave in excess of statutory entitlement
Dedicated learning and development opportunities
Flexible working arrangements
